For breakfast, Clarissa can choose from oatmeal, cereal, French toast, or scrambled eggs. She thinks that if she selects a break

fast at random, it is likely that it will be oatmeal. ls she correct? Explain your reasoning.
Mathematics
2 answers:
Leona [35]3 years ago
3 0
No. If she selects a breakfast at random there is an equal chance she will select each item. 25% chance she will select oatmeal, 25% chance she will select cereal, 25% she will select french toast, and a 25% chance she will select scrambled eggs.
